Atmospheric pressure, also known as barometric pressure (after the barometer), is the pressure within the atmosphere of Earth.The standard atmosphere (symbol: atm) is a unit of pressure defined as 101,325 Pa (1,013.25 hPa; 1,013.25 mbar), which is equivalent to 760 mm Hg, 29.9212 inches Hg, or 14.696 psi. One pascal is defined as one newton per square meter. In physics, Pascal's principle says that given a fluid in a totally enclosed system, a change in pressure at one point in the fluid is transmitted to all points in the fluid, as well as to the enclosing walls. The sensitivity of the microphone in volts per pascal of sound pressure is known; therefore the instrument can accurately convert the voltage back into pascals and then calculate the sound pressure level in decibels P SPL using the formula. V = Sqrt [ (2*q/p) ] Where V is the velocity (m/s) q is the dynamic pressure (pascals) p is the fluid mass density (kg/m^3) Pressure to Velocity Definition.
